LRQA Nettitude join the 2020-2022 Global Executive Assessor Roundtable (GEAR) – lead by the PCI Security Standards Council

 

The PCI Security Standards Council (PCI SSC) have announced the 2020-2022 PCI SSC Global Executive Assessor Roundtable.

Leamington Spa, Warwickshire: LRQA Nettitude have been selected to join the 2020-2022 Global Executive Assessor Roundtable (GEAR). The PCI SSC Global Executive Assessor Roundtable is an Executive Committee level advisory board comprised of senior executives from PCI SSC assessor companies and serves as a direct channel for communication between senior leadership of Payment Security Assessors and PCI SSC senior leadership.

LRQA Nettitude is one of 28 organisations to join the PCI Security Standards Council’s Global Executive Assessor Roundtable in its efforts to secure payment data globally. As strategic partners, Roundtable members bring industry, geographical and technical insight to PCI SSC plans and projects on behalf of the assessor community.

About the PCI Security Standards Council:

The PCI Security Standards Council (PCI SSC) leads a global, cross-industry effort to increase payment security by providing industry-driven, flexible and effective data security standards and programs that help businesses detect, mitigate and prevent cyberattacks and breaches.
